1982 Bitter SC vs. 2009 Honda S2000

To start off, 2009 Honda S2000 is newer by 27 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Bitter SC.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Bitter SC would be higher. At 2,967 cc (6 cylinders), 1982 Bitter SC is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Honda S2000 (237 HP @ 7800 RPM) has 60 more horse power than 1982 Bitter SC. (177 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Honda S2000 should accelerate faster than 1982 Bitter SC.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1982 Bitter SC weights approximately 407 kg more than 2009 Honda S2000.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1982 Bitter SC (248 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 28 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Honda S2000. (220 Nm @ 6800 RPM). This means 1982 Bitter SC will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Honda S2000.
